Abstract

A method utilizing continual sensor-based data to design an adjustable set of corrective braking/accelerating actions for a vehicle. The invention capabilities include cognizance of the dynamic workings of the vehicle in a changing real environment. For example, the forces and accelerations experienced by the vehicle during normal driving operations, may be taken into design account, to thereby provide an optimal balance between safety, support, and comfort.
